The municipality of Presidente Lucena (2,901 inhabitants; 4,972 ha) is 
located 70 km north of Porto Alegre.

The flag of Presidente Lucena shall be divided in vertical stripes, from left 
to right, green, white and blue, in equal size. The flag's proportions are 14 
units in width on 20 units in length. The central stripe shall be charged with 
the municipal coat of arms.

The coat of arms of the municipality of Presidente Lucena is 
based on Portuguese heraldry, which is the origin of Brazilian heraldry, with 
its principles and symbolism. It was artistically elaborated with mystic and 
allegoric rigor as required by usual heraldry, with colors obeying the following 
codification. Or (gold) is a symbol of force and wealth; azure (blue), of 
beauty; sable (black), of prudence; argent (silver), of history; gules (red), of 
justice and honor; vert (green), of natural environment.
The coat of arms 
features a sun or, representing birth, dawn, a new municipality, with its rays 
illuminating everything, on a limpid and clear sky. The hills represent the 
local topography. The buildings represent the town's skyline, with industries 
and churches.
The open book reflects the main production of the community, 
that is, education. God Mercury's helmet superimposed to a cogwheel is the 
universal symbol of industry and commerce. The branches of olives surrounding a 
handshake represent the successful unity in the process that culminated with the 
municipality' emancipation. The colonist's family standing on a plowed field 
recall those who built with their arms the municipality's income, and still 
maintain it through agriculture.
The scroll gules represents protection and 
justice. The maize plant and the sugarcane represent agricultural production. 
The three-towered mural crown represents the three powers, Legislative, 
Executive and Judiciary, and a third-rank town, seat of a municipality.
